Top Searches for this datasheetSi4174DY_RC Thermal Model Parameters parametric values thermal model have been derived using curve-fitting techniques. values electrical circuit Foster/Tank Cauer/Filter configurations included. When implemented P-Spice, these values have matching characteristic curves single-pulse transient thermal impedance curves MOSFET. These values used P-SPICE simulation evaluate thermal behavior MOSFET junction temperature under defined power profile. These techniques described Application Note AN609, "Thermal Simulation Power MOSFETs P-Spice Platform."
